Hi,
I'm testing Android 8.1 (oreo-x86 branch of android-x86)
with the following gfx stack:
- drm_hwcomposer of freedesktop.org (hwctwo enabled and also with robherring
branch handle-rework)
- latest gbm_gralloc (robherring branch handle-rework, but also happening with
branches prior to handle-rework)
- latest libdrm, but it happens will all releases from 2.4.89(and before) to
2.4.91
- latest kernel 4.17rc4, but it happens with all kernels
Hardware: Laptop Lenovo T460 with Skylake GT2
Synthomps: Bootanimation completes, but then the Android GUI hangs and
surfaceflinger service is killed, Bootanimations restarts (GUI bootloop)
Very difficult to get debug logs, about what is causing signal 1 (SIGHUP)
killing surfaceflinger, but I could finally trace it.
05-07 21:36:58.689 0 0 I : [drm] GPU HANG: ecode
9:0:0x00280000, in surfaceflinger [2497], reason: No progress on rcs0, action:
reset
05-07 21:36:58.689 0 0 I : [drm] GPU hangs can indicate a bug
anywhere in the entire gfx stack, including userspace.
05-07 21:36:58.689 0 0 I : [drm] Please file a _new_ bug report
on bugs.freedesktop.org against DRI -> DRM/Intel
05-07 21:36:58.689 0 0 I : [drm] drm/i915 developers can then
reassign to the right component if it's not a kernel issue.
05-07 21:36:58.689 0 0 I : [drm] The gpu crash dump is required
to analyze gpu hangs, so please always attach it.
05-07 21:36:58.689 0 0 I : [drm] GPU crash dump saved to
/sys/class/drm/card0/error
05-07 21:36:58.689 0 0 I i915 0000: 00:02.0: Resetting rcs0 after gpu
hang
logcat, dmesg and GPU crash dump /sys/class/drm/card0/error are provided.
Please help to identify the root cause as this is probably the only show
stopper preventing drm_hwcomposer (hwctwo) + gbm_gralloc + libdrm from booting
Android oreo-x86 with full freedesktop stack.
